Commit Graph

3405 Commits

Author SHA1 Message Date
Michael Snoyman
f779004d19 Merge yesod-routes into yesod-core entirely 2014-09-07 17:34:37 +03:00
Michael Snoyman
88b9217e25 Merge branch 'master' into yesod-1.4 2014-09-07 17:02:01 +03:00
Michael Snoyman
815901eeb4 Version bump 2014-09-07 16:58:00 +03:00
Michael Snoyman
be5ec95647 Clean up parsing module further 2014-09-07 16:55:37 +03:00
Michael Snoyman
bc00f3958f Unified parsing and dispatching code (still ugly) 2014-09-07 16:55:37 +03:00
Michael Snoyman
a1ea34f196 Remove old dispatch method 2014-09-07 16:55:37 +03:00
Michael Snoyman
97af86e43a Simplified done.cg #819 2014-09-03 17:56:20 +03:00
Michael Snoyman
8cbcc5fab3 Merge branch 'master' into yesod-1.4 2014-09-03 09:03:18 +03:00
Michael Snoyman
67438d191d optparse-applicative 0.10 2014-09-03 08:20:10 +03:00
Greg Weber
ec91c8b59b version bump 2014-09-01 20:19:25 -07:00
Greg Weber
867f0c02e0 Merge pull request #818 from HugoDaniel/patch-1
Fixes the "reader not in scope" error
2014-09-01 12:27:43 -05:00
Hugo Daniel
525a73a100 Update yesod-bin.cabal
This fixes the error:

[10 of 10] Compiling Main             ( main.hs, dist/build/yesod/yesod-tmp/Main.o )

main.hs:192:35:
    Not in scope: ‘reader’
    Perhaps you meant one of these:
      ‘header’ (imported from Options.Applicative),
      ‘readIO’ (imported from Prelude), ‘readLn’ (imported from Prelude)
cabal: Error: some packages failed to install:
yesod-bin-1.2.12.5 failed during the building phase. The exception was:
ExitFailure 1
2014-09-01 18:12:20 +01:00
Michael Snoyman
2187c0cf8d Add required to textareaField (fixes #817) 2014-09-01 07:19:15 +03:00
Michael Snoyman
3478841d15 Add required to textareaField (fixes #817) 2014-09-01 07:18:42 +03:00
Michael Snoyman
34980eff82 Merge pull request #816 from yesodweb/install-j
use -j for cabal install
2014-08-31 09:55:25 +03:00
Greg Weber
07c1baefc4 use -j for cabal install 2014-08-30 19:16:49 -07:00
Michael Snoyman
29d7e252f1 Merge branch 'master' into yesod-1.4 2014-08-31 05:04:27 +03:00
Michael Snoyman
1e76a28f6d withUrlRenderer 2014-08-31 02:24:08 +03:00
Michael Snoyman
ebf3c8e4f2 Scaffolding update for #814 2014-08-31 00:22:34 +03:00
Michael Snoyman
9471399589 Merge branch 'master' into yesod-1.4 2014-08-28 05:19:21 +03:00
Michael Snoyman
d6b3d2a890 conduit 1.2 version bumps 2014-08-27 18:01:02 +03:00
Michael Snoyman
d3df218a96 conduit 1.2 patch 2014-08-27 17:34:35 +03:00
Michael Snoyman
fc66819535 Merge branch 'master' into yesod-1.4
Conflicts:
	yesod-form/yesod-form.cabal
2014-08-27 11:18:21 +03:00
Michael Snoyman
8b2297adf4 Conditional support for persistent2 branch.
Pinging @gregwebs. I've backported the relevant tweaks on the yesod-1.4
branch, to allow master to compile against persistent2. Whenever you're
ready to release persistent2, we can:

1. Release persistent2.
2. Release new versions of yesod packages, which will work with
   persistent 1.3 and 2.0.
3. Add an upper bound in Stackage to avoid using the new persistent
   libraries until they're ready for primetime.
4. Release your blog post.

yesod-1.4 should then remove the CPP here and only work with
persistent2; the biggest "breaking change" in the 1.4 release will be
remove backwards compatibility hacks for persistent, conduit,
shakespeare, and wai.
2014-08-27 11:16:08 +03:00
Michael Snoyman
30352f56ec Some fixes for persistent2 2014-08-27 10:53:17 +03:00
Michael Snoyman
6eb1447dd9 Add missing LANGUAGE pragma 2014-08-27 08:15:47 +03:00
Michael Snoyman
a6d545fe32 Merge branch 'master' into yesod-1.4 2014-08-27 07:51:39 +03:00
Michael Snoyman
1539753562 Relax conduit upper bound 2014-08-27 07:44:26 +03:00
Michael Snoyman
a13ebd3fa8 Some merge resolution 2014-08-25 21:20:27 +03:00
Michael Snoyman
c66ef04f17 Merge branch 'master' into yesod-1.4
Conflicts:
	yesod-form/Yesod/Form/Functions.hs
2014-08-25 20:20:16 +03:00
Michael Snoyman
b2c16c9d4c Scaffolding update: turn on -N 2014-08-25 18:07:58 +03:00
Michael Snoyman
641135f011 Version bump 2014-08-25 10:38:43 +03:00
Michael Snoyman
7146b62086 Merge pull request #812 from cosmo0920/bump-up-lowerbound-aeson
yesod-auth: bump up lower bound for aeson
2014-08-24 14:09:53 +03:00
cosmo0920
1f20cc0004 yesod-auth: bump up lower bound for aeson
Because `Data.Aeson.Encode.encodeToTextBuilder` is added since
aeson-0.7.0.0.
2014-08-24 19:55:19 +09:00
Michael Snoyman
a3ec07c359 Disable broken test 2014-08-23 21:50:38 +03:00
Michael Snoyman
1c775e37c0 Version bump 2014-08-21 07:19:49 +03:00
Michael Snoyman
fd9518d747 Merge pull request #810 from yesodweb/bump-persistent
bump persistent versions
2014-08-21 07:18:59 +03:00
Greg Weber
7fa8f8a3dd bump persistent versions
this allows the latest version of persistent-mongoDB to be installed
2014-08-20 12:05:30 -07:00
Michael Snoyman
e091096388 Version bump 2014-08-20 18:46:01 +03:00
Michael Snoyman
2ad3227776 Version bumps 2014-08-20 17:54:46 +03:00
Michael Snoyman
9c3cf3e4c5 Scaffolding updates 2014-08-20 17:53:06 +03:00
Michael Snoyman
17016f8427 Merge branch 'master' of github.com:yesodweb/yesod 2014-08-20 16:46:21 +03:00
Michael Snoyman
40547b2b71 Merge pull request #809 from dunric/master
`required' attribute for nicHtmlField (textarea tag)
2014-08-20 16:04:32 +03:00
Dunric
d4175f11cc `required' attribute for nicHtmlField (textfield tag) 2014-08-20 01:53:59 +02:00
Michael Snoyman
827ddf8be5 Merge pull request #808 from dunric/master
Add some minimal interaction to add-handler command
2014-08-18 09:16:46 +03:00
Dunric
9831220c47 add-handler interactive 2014-08-17 20:15:50 +02:00
Michael Snoyman
587080dbff Merge pull request #797 from wuzzeb/master
Include google person information in the credsExtra field for GoogleEmail2 auth
2014-08-17 11:20:29 +03:00
Michael Snoyman
a70de71d8e Merge branch 'master' of github.com:yesodweb/yesod 2014-08-16 23:06:29 +03:00
Michael Snoyman
404e1b2f9c Platform update 2014-08-16 23:05:58 +03:00
Michael Snoyman
63e7cd8e2f network/network-uri split (again) 2014-08-16 23:05:10 +03:00